      "Shows teachers how to create a mathematically-rich physical environment and guide children's mathematics learning through focused lessons and integrated learning throughout the day. Supplements The Creative Curriculum for Preschool, a comprehensive curriculum for children ages 3-5. Discusses the components of mathematics, mathematical process skills, mathematics learning in interest areas, and mathematics activities"--Provided by publisher.

      The Creative Curriculum balances both teacher-directed and child-initiated learning, with an emphasis on responding to children's learning styles and building on their strengths and interests. This completely updated new edition of one of the country's leading research-based preschool curricula applies the latest theory and research on best practices in teaching and learning and the content standards developed by states and professional organizations. While keeping the original environmentally-based approach of earlier editions, The Creative Curriculum for Preschool clearly defines the teacher's vital role in connecting content, teaching, and learning for preschool children. It features goals and objectives linked directly to our valid and reliable assessment instrument (The Creative Curriculum Developmental Continuum for Ages 3-5).
